I'm looking to have a custom seat mount made. I'm located in the san diego area, are there any shops here, or in the LA area, that you guys could reccomend? the problem I have w/ the wedge engineering (furnished by sparco) mounts is that they actually raised my seat height, and being that I have a long torso, this makes driving with a helmet an impossibility.
Any reccomendations will be greatly appreciated. Thank you.
